The cheapest way to get from Páros to Agios Kirykos is to car ferry and ferry which costs €35 - €90 and takes 4h.
The fastest way to get from Páros to Agios Kirykos is to car ferry and ferry which takes 4h and costs €35 - €90.
No, there is no direct ferry from Páros to Agios Kirykos. However, there are services departing from Paros and arriving at Ag. Kirykos via Mykonos.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h.
The distance between Páros and Agios Kirykos is 151 km.
